Dragonball Movie Gets New Name

Late changes and reworks are never a good omen for a film, and the news just gets more and more troubling for the widely-panned Dragonball movie--now rennamed "Dragonball Evolution".

No word as to why, but it seems as though 20th Century Fox has extended the title of its upcoming "Dragon Ball" adaptation to Dragonball Evolution. We should get confirmation of this change soon, but the evidence is in the fact that 20th Century Fox has also registered the domain name DragonballEvolutionmovie.com, which currently takes you to FoxMovies.com.

Opening in theaters April 8th, 2009. Dragonball Evolution is written and directed by James Wong, and stars: Justin Chatwin, James Marsters, Jamie Chung, Emmy Rossum, Eriko Tamura, Joon Park, Chow Yun-Fat, Texas Battle, Randall Duk Kim and Ernie Hudson.
